Output 51084d37aedf9acb33a00317cdd1080bf3678124c19a889785811d902a3884ca:3

value
5889046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b93ef2f976e9d1a689b3935f055e52ef970be8d OP_EQUAL
address
3LFSK9CCFw4GbL5a4RUAwJozSD3SMPXKPP
transaction
51084d37aedf9acb33a00317cdd1080bf3678124c19a889785811d902a3884ca
spent
true